If the van has a diesel engine, then you MUST use diesel fuel. Unleaded gasoline will destroy a diesel engine. Diesel fuel is also used as a lubricant in a diesel engine. The use of any other fuel except diesel will result in serious damage. The expected lifespan of a Swift diesel engine can typically range from 10 to 15 years, or around 150,000 to 200,000 kilometers, depending on maintenance, driving conditions, and usage patterns. Regular servicing and adherence to manufacturer guidelines can significantly extend its longevity. Additionally, factors such as fuel quality and driving habits play a crucial role in determining the overall lifespan of the engine.
